What are the similarities between EB-1(a) and EB-1(b)?

0

The similarities are: 1) Both of them are in the EB-1 category. Therefore, immigrant visa numbers are immediately available to all successful petitioners from any country. 2) Neither needs a Labor Certification and 3) Both have premium processing service. Premium processing means that USCIS processes the petition within fifteen days if the applicant pays $1,000 in premium processing fees.
